Fabric

A man and a shirt have a close relationship. Literally. As the thing worn closest to your skin, the fabric better feel right. 100% cotton has been the go-to for decades (centuries if you look past the contemporary dress shirt), and it’s still a top choice for its crisp feel and easy breathability. But don’t sleep on modern stretch blends and performance fabrics. They have caught up, and, yes, in some cases exceeded cotton’s soft touch and natural benefits. Finish

Quality and style are all about attention to detail. It’s the way a button-down collar rolls at the neckline, a shirttail that stays tucked in, seams that don’t pucker—everything down to the stitching. It’s also about carefully chosen colors and patterns, timeless for any occasion but not boring.
